What is rigging hardware?

Rigging hardware refers to the essential components used to connect, secure, lift, tension, and control wire rope systems across demanding industrial environments. Rigging hardware forms the backbone of safe and efficient lifting, marine, construction, and heavy-industry operations. Turnbuckle (adjustable) sockets

Combining socket strength with fine-tuned tension control, adjustable sockets are essential for structural cable systems and precise length adjustment.

Global Rope Fittings offers turnbuckle sockets in two configurations: open and closed.

  • Open turnbuckle sockets allow for easy connection to external rigging components and are particularly suited for applications where accessibility and adjustment speed are important.
  • Closed turnbuckle sockets provide a fully enclosed termination, offering increased stability and security in structural and long-term installations.

Wire rope clips & thimbles

Supporting safe terminations and protecting rope integrity in lifting and securing operations.

Global Rope Fittings supplies both wire rope clips and solid wire rope thimbles as reliable supporting components within complete wire rope assemblies.

  • Wire rope clips are used to create temporary or adjustable terminations by securing the free end of a wire rope. When correctly installed, they provide a practical and flexible solution for non-permanent applications.
  • Solid wire rope thimbles are designed to protect the rope eye against abrasion, deformation, and premature wear. By maintaining the correct bend radius, thimbles significantly extend the service life of wire rope terminations.

FAQs about rigging hardware

What is rigging hardware used for?
Rigging hardware is used to connect, lift, secure, and tension wire rope systems in industries such as marine, offshore, construction, crane operations, mining, and infrastructure.

What types of components do I need for my application?
This depends on load requirements, rope diameter, environmental conditions, and whether the termination must be permanent or adjustable. Our team can advise based on your specifications.

Can they be reused?
Some components, such as wedge sockets, can be reused if inspected correctly. Permanent solutions like spelter sockets should not be reused, which is why you should always consult a specialist first.
